Deck Description

This is a casual deck built around a Legendary theme, helmed by Arvad the Cursed, a cool uncommon legendary card that boosts almost all of your creatures. And what to do with this army of legendary awesomeness? Beat the living crap of your opponents, of course!

Arvad the Cursed may give +2/+2 to your army, but it's not the only one to give bonus to legends.

Elesh Norn Grand Cenobite pumps your creatures while weakening the opposition. Day of Destiny, Ravos, Soultender, card:Heroes' Podium and many other cards will make your legendary army bigger and meaner to smash other players, while card:Odric, Lunarch Marshal, card:Masako the Humorless will give some other kind of bonuses, making you confortable for all out attacks.

Dominaria gave some nice toys for a legendary theme deck. And one of the greatest are Yawgmoth's Vile Offering (which is the only card with a Yawgmoth picture in all of MTG) and Primevals' Glorious Rebirth. Both cards return creatures from your graveyard to the battlefield, with Primevals' Glorious Rebirth being fantastic to restore all of your army to full power in no time.
However, you can count with Yomiji, Who Bars the Way and Sheoldred, Whispering One to return all of your legendary creatures to the battlefield or to your hand, saving them from death. Or better yet, Avacyn, Angel of Hope will turn your board indestructible and ready for everything (except for mass exiles, nothing can be perfect).

As your army of heroes rise, it's almost certain that your opponents will try to cast mass removals to stop your advancement. You may have reanimate options and cards like Teferi's Protection and Avacyn, Angel of Hope for protection, but many mass removals can ruin your day easily. Actually, any anti-creatures strategy can be quite problematic against this deck.
As if it wasn't enough, if you empty your hand, there are not many draw spells or cards that can help you. Sure, there are some like The Immortal Sun and Phyrexian Arena, but there are few and far between.

Overall, the deck really wants to play an agressive to midrange strategy, favoring combat and legend synergies to overcome your opponents, having options to reanimate them. It is a casual deck, but it can be really powerful and can be a blast to play, but take care with mass removals and hard control players.
